In which software c programming is done

In fact, a lot of fun programming is done in c for instance, system software and data managers such as berkeley db. Pwct is a generalpurpose visual programming language designed for novice and expert programmers. The computer programming for beginners course is the perfect place to begin with programming. Now its time to try a little propeller c programming. Create software without writing a single line of code. For example, if a program is part of a system of several programs, the programmer coordinates with other programmers to make sure that the programs fit together well.

Sep 20, 2019 c one of the older computer languages, but still widelyused. Some programs might have thousands or millions of lines and to manage such programs it becomes quite. C is more of a hardware programming language, there are easy gui builders for c, gtk, glade, etc. It can often be used in a variety of applications and functions with other components of the system. C programming language free software downloads and. Firmware for various electronics, industrial and communications products which use microcontrollers. Apr 29, 20 a blog by jeff atwood on programming and human factors. How to install c language software in windows 7, 8. C program to find the largest number among three numbers. This language is easy to learn and a good start for beginners. Design flowchart in programming with examples programiz. Pay someone to do my programming homework coding help 20% off. This is on a window 10 machine, just installed a few weeks ago. We have been doing programming assignments for students for over 10 years and you can count on our expertise to get your programming assignment for school done as fast as possible.

Hollywood has helped instill an image of programmers as uber techies who can sit down at a. What is computer programming and what do programs do. C programming is an excellent language to learn to program for beginners. If you know the language, you can get a computer to do almost anything you want. Download this app from microsoft store for windows 10 mobile, windows phone 8. C programming exercises, practice, solution w3resource. Computer programming is the process of designing and building an executable computer program to accomplish a specific computing result. The c programming language was created by dennis ritchie from the unix operating system in 1972. Programming software for windows free downloads and. C program to demonstrate the working of keyword long. While many highlevel languages have surpassed c in usage for certain applications, the c programming language remains unrivaled for software that must harness the true power of the machine. C was designed to model a cpu, because c was created to make unix portable across platforms instead of just writing assembly language.

In todays article, toptal developer daniel angel munoz trejo shows us. Microsoft visual basic roblox studio visual studio professional 2017 smart apps creator. C is used to develop lowlevel programs, and works very closely with the computers hardware. Programming is a creative process that instructs a computer on how to do a task. Software programming is part and parcel of our modern digital life and there is almost nothing in our urban surrounding that is not benefited by the contributions of software. Programming is the process of creating a set of instructions that tell a computer how to perform a task. Hollywood has helped instill an image of programmers as uber techies who can sit down at a computer and break any password in seconds. I get a surprising number of emails from career programmers who have spent some time in the profession and eventually decided it just isnt for them. The purpose of c is to precisely define a series of operations that a computer can perform to accomplish a task. Actual programming of software code is done during the. Nov 05, 2016 the second thing to do for embedded system programming is to learn the programming language. Though flowcharts can be useful writing and analysis of a program, drawing a flowchart for complex programs can be more complicated than writing the program itself.

Hello friends,in this instructable, i have shown how to program arduino uno in c language. Top 5 programming languages to learn in 2018 to get a job without a college. C c is one of the older languages still in use, and is the basis for most of the other languages on this list. Hence, creating flowcharts for complex programs is often ignored. Why the c programming language still runs the world toptal. By design, c provides constructs that map efficiently to typical machine instructions and has found lasting use in. Jan 07, 2020 well, c is a building block of many other programming languages that programmers use today. Code blocks is a software specially designed for programming. Programming c is the first in a threepart series being published by.

C is a generalpurpose, imperative computer programming language, supporting structured programming, lexical variable scope and recursion, while a static type system prevents many unintended operations. Originally intended for writing system software, c was developed at bell labs by dennis ritchie for the unix operating system in the early 1970s. If you have not done so already, go to the start simple tutorial and try the programming examples, then come back here when you are done. If you are a programmer, or if you are interested in becoming a programmer, there are a couple of benefits you gain from learning c. Jan 28, 2017 how to download c programming software sarosh ashar. C programming can be used to do verity of tasks such as networking related,os related. This app teaches you the basics of the c programming language. C is a programming language originally developed for developing the unix operating system. Ranked among the most widely used languages, c has a. In this document, we will see how we can compile and execute c program in linux and windows.

Most of the applications by adobe are developed using c programming language. Folder protection software in c programming code with c. It is used for developing browsers and their extensions. So im wondering which other software do i have, looking for the best option actually. This mean that c programs work well as a programming language for programs that need to have an abstraction level very close to the actual cpu, which is the case for embedded hardware. Our c tutorials will guide you to learn c programming one step at a time. If you want to write a great, fast game, c is again a great choice. It is a lowlevel and powerful language, but it lacks many modern and useful constructs. C is one of the oldest programming languages around.

C program to check whether a number is even or odd. The document also contains a list of c compilers available. C program to check whether a character is a vowel or consonant. C programming for windows 10 free download and software.

The only things you cant do in c are accessing stack pointers and condition registers etc, of the cpu core itself. A computer programmer, sometimes called more recently a coder especially in more informal contexts, is a person who creates computer software. Before you start writing in c, you will need some c programming software. The implementation of exception handling in programming languages typically involves a fair amount of support from both a code generator and the runtime system accompanying a compiler. C programming is near to machine as well as human so it is called as middle level programming language.

Its versatility, efficiency and good performance makes it an excellent choice. We provide you best programming assignment help by coing your programming projects, conducting your online programming exams, and many more. It can be used to develop software like operating systems, databases, compilers, and so on. The problem is making a program in c that is the easy part, making a gui that is a easy part, the hard part is to combine both, to interface between your program and the gui is a headache, and different gui use different ways, some threw global. Literature, history and culture of c programming language. Software development is a process of writing and maintaining the source code, but in a broader sense, it includes all that is involved between the conception of the desired.

Download the latest version of the top software, games, programs and apps in 2020. Most of the embedded system products are designed such that they support c language. Software development is the process of conceiving, specifying, designing, programming, documenting, testing, and bug fixing involved in creating and maintaining applications, frameworks, or other software components. Arduino uses its own language to program arduino boards,because its programming language is easy to understand. Which will be the best software to use c programming. Feb 12, 2020 download programming without coding technology for free. How to start learning computer programming with pictures. Code with c is a comprehensive compilation of free projects, source codes, books, and tutorials in java, php.

A compiler is a sophisticated piece of software for converting the c source code you write with your text editor into the machine code that you can execute on your computer. You should use a commandline compiler, linker and library manager. You should not use a big fancy ide that will conceal all of the workings of the build system, whihc is act. Programming languages play vital role in the building and progress of computing technology. Building websites for any need, web applications or deploying custom cloud software solutions have never been easier. C is a powerful generalpurpose programming language. The c programming language doesnt seem to have an expiration date. Its closeness to the hardware, great portability and deterministic usage of resources makes it ideal for low level development for such things as operating system kernels and embedded software. This will help you get familiar with the simpleide software and the propeller c language and simple libraries. Pwct is not a wizard for creating your application in 1 2 3 steps. If you want to be able to do more than write a simple web app, c is a great language. The best free programming software app downloads for windows. For linux and unix operating systems, we will be using gnu gcc to compile c program. The term computer programmer can refer to a specialist in one area of computers, or to a generalist who writes code for many kinds of software a programmers most oftused computer language e.

If you are done with c programming language then its time to. Hardware programming can be done directly in either language. Actual programming of software code is done during the step. With a team of programmers in each programming language, you can be sure that we are the right team to do your programming homework. Do my programming homework is a significant portion of computer studies in the event youre one of the students who is seeking professional and authentic guidance about the subject, your wait ends at us. Get the scoop on how c works and why its so important. You should use whatever editor youre comfortable andor proficient with. There is also a quiz which lets you check how well you have learnt the language. Programmers around the world embrace c because it gives maximum control and efficiency to the programmer. All of us have heard the term and have a vague idea of what it involves but few of us know it by original definition. It locked up while it was parsing i removed it, and installed verison 5.

Assembler is a lower level programming language than c,so this makes it a good for programming directly to hardware. C program to find the size of int, float, double and char. Mysql is the most popular database software which is built using c. C was originally developed by dennis ritchie between 1969 and 1973 at bell labs, and used to reimplement the unix operating system. The programming activities just described could be done, perhaps, as solo activities, but a programmer typically interacts with a variety of people. Modular programming is the process of subdividing a computer program into separate subprograms. C is a highlevel and generalpurpose programming language that is ideal for developing firmware or portable applications. Compile and execute c program in linux and windows w3resource. Our main mission is to help out programmers and coders, students and learners in general, with relevant resources and materials in the field of computer programming.

Rexcoders as programming sector of c planet malta is dedicated to building custom solutions for wide selection of customers needs. Get this app while signed in to your microsoft account and. The c programming language is a popular and widely used programming language for creating computer programs. Before you can write a program, you need an editor and a compiler. Unlike for and while loops, which test the loop condition at the top of the loop, the do. To do that, you will need two different pieces of software. Googles chromium is built using c programming language. But i would like the c programmers opinion about it, remmember just c.